Crawl Space Water Removal Cost in Madisonville, LA

The cost of crawl space water removal in Madisonville, LA can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ide you with a free estimate after assessing the damage. Here’s a breakdown of typical price ranges for different services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Removal $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Sanitizing and Cleaning $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Final Inspection and Certification $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Emergency Response $100 – $500 Time of day and urgency of response
More Services (e.g., insulation replacement, drywall repair) $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of damage and complexity of repair

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ment by our team. We offer free estimates and flexible payment options to ensure you can afford the services you need.

How do I prevent water damage in my crawl space?

To prevent water damage in your crawl space, ensure that your home’s drainage system is functioning correctly, and consider installing a sump pump or French drain. Regular inspections and maintenance can also help identify potential issues before they become major problems.
